Understanding Highway Use Tax

What is the Highway Use Tax?

A highway use tax is imposed on vehicles that operate on public roads. It is targeted primarily at large vehicles, which are a major contributor to wear and tear. This tax will ensure that people who drive more often contribute equally towards their repair.

Who Needs to File Highway Use Tax?

The owners of heavy vehicles typically, those with an average gross weight of 55,000 or more are required to pay the highway use tax. This applies to Independent Owners, Fleet Owners, and Tax Preparers. Both people must understand their responsibilities to avoid penalties that could be unexpected.

When is the Highway Use Tax Due?

The standard deadline is every year on August 31st. This heavy vehicle is utilized from July 1st to June 30th of the following year, which is the start of the tax period.

Tips to Ensure Accurate Highway Use Tax Filing

Double-Check Your Vehicle Information: To review the details about your vehicle thoroughly, such as the weight and VIN, to ensure accuracy. Incorrect information could result in your files being denied and potential fines.
Maintain Detailed Mileage Records: Ensure you keep a thorough and accurate log of the miles you drive each year. This data is essential for confirming your tax calculations and can serve as evidence if an audit occurs.
Consult a Tax Professional for Complex Issues: It's crucial to get guidance from a licensed tax professional when handling complex tax circumstances or filing challenges. They will assist you in adhering to all relevant legal standards and protect your funds by helping you avoid costly errors.
